First, I want to thank everyone for making this year’s Holiday Toy Drive a record-breaking success. With your help, we collected and distributed more than 13,000 toys to local families in need. I also want to recognize our outstanding County employees, who collectively pledged more than $1.4 million to support the annual Heart of Florida United Way Giving Campaign to help our community.
